How long does a typical roof replacement take in Armonk?

Most residential roof replacements in Armonk take 2-4 days, depending on the size of your home and weather conditions. We start by removing your old roofing materials and inspecting the roof deck for any damage that needs repair.

The actual installation follows, including proper ventilation, flashing, and gutter work. We don’t rush the job—quality installation is what makes the difference between a roof that lasts 15 years and one that lasts 30 years.

Weather can extend the timeline since we won’t install roofing materials in rain or high winds. But we’ll tarp and secure your home if weather interrupts the project, so you’re never left exposed.

Armonk’s climate demands materials that handle freeze-thaw cycles, high winds, and heavy precipitation. Architectural asphalt shingles are the most popular choice because they offer excellent weather protection at a reasonable cost and complement our area’s traditional home styles.

Metal roofing is gaining popularity, especially for ranch-style homes. It sheds snow and ice effectively, resists wind damage, and provides excellent energy efficiency during our humid summers. The initial investment is higher, but metal roofs often last 50+ years with minimal maintenance.

For commercial properties, modified bitumen and TPO systems work well for flat roofs. These materials handle our temperature extremes and provide reliable waterproofing for businesses throughout the area.

Our roof inspections cover every component of your roofing system. We examine shingles or other roofing materials for damage, wear, or missing pieces. We check all flashing around chimneys, vents, and roof penetrations—these are common leak points that many contractors miss.

Gutters, downspouts, and drainage systems get inspected for proper function and attachment. We also evaluate ventilation to ensure your attic stays properly ventilated, which is crucial for preventing ice dams in winter and reducing cooling costs in summer.

You receive a detailed report with photos showing our findings, plus recommendations for any repairs or maintenance needed. We explain everything clearly so you understand exactly what your roof needs and why.

Age is the first factor—most asphalt shingle roofs in Armonk need replacement after 20-25 years, depending on the quality of materials and installation. But other signs can indicate problems earlier, especially after severe weather events.

Missing, cracked, or curling shingles are obvious red flags. Interior sign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, especially after storms. If you’re finding granules from shingles in your gutters regularly, that indicates accelerated wear.

The best approach is a professional inspection. We can tell you honestly whether repairs will solve your problems or if replacement makes more financial sense. Sometimes a few strategic repairs can extend your roof’s life by several years.
